Frequently Asked Questions about Siberian Huskies
1. What are the characteristics of a Siberian Husky?
A Siberian Husky is known for its striking appearance, friendly behavior, and strong work ethic. They are medium-sized dogs with a thick double coat, erect triangular ears, and distinctive markings. Huskies are very active and require lots of exercise and social interaction.

3. What should I know about the health of a Siberian Husky?
Huskies are generally healthy dogs, but they can be prone to certain genetic conditions. It’s important to keep them up to date on vaccinations and deworming. A responsible breeder will provide health clearances for the puppy's parents and ensure the puppy is up to date on necessary shots and treatments.
4. Are Siberian Huskies good with families and children?
Yes, Siberian Huskies are known for their friendly nature, making them great family pets. They typically get along well with children and can be very playful and affectionate.
5. How much exercise does a Siberian Husky need?
A Siberian Husky requires a significant amount of exercise daily. Ideally, they need at least 1-2 hours of vigorous activity to keep them physically and mentally stimulated. This can include walks, runs, and playtime.
6. What is the ideal living situation for a Siberian Husky?
Siberian Huskies do best in homes with ample space to run and play. They thrive in environments where they can be active and engage with their families. They do well in homes with fenced yards or access to open areas.
